What Does A K-1 Visa Do?

A K-1 visa is issued to an eligible person, which allows them to legally enter the United States for the purpose of entering into a marriage. The marriage must take place within 90 days after a person has arrived. Marriage alone is not enough to make a person a legal citizen of the U.S. After the marriage has taken place, the foreign spouse may apply for an adjustment of status to a legal permanent resident.

The Application Process

The U.S. citizen will act as a sponsor to their foreign-born fiancé. The sponsor must first fill out the necessary forms and file them with the local U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) office. Upon approval from a USCIS officer, the application will be processed by the National Visa Center, who will then send a notification to the U.S. Embassy or consulate of the fiancé’s home country. Once the National Visa Center has sent a notification, the fiancé should collect all the required documents and begin preparing for an interview. Documents that must be presented in the visa interview include:

  • A nonimmigrant visa application
  • A valid passport that does not expire for at least six months
  • Proof of financial support
  • Two 2 X 2 photographs
  • Proof of relationship with the U.S. sponsor

Additional documents may be necessary depending on the circumstances of your situation. The amount of time it takes to secure a K-1 visa varies from case to case.
